About The Position

We are seeking a highly skilled Reliability Engineer to support aviation system sustainment and performance improvement efforts. This role is critical in ensuring the safety, reliability, and maintainability of aircraft systems, with a focus on predictive and preventative maintenance strategies.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in reliability engineering within the aviation sector, preferably with experience supporting USAF fighter aircraft platforms.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in engineering or related technical discipline.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in a reliability engineering role within a manufacturing or aviation environment.
  • Firm understanding of Failure Mode and Effects Analysis (FMEA) and Failure Modes, Effects, and Criticality Analysis (FMECA).
  • Proficiency with reliability analysis tools, statistical software, and diagnostic equipment.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ills.
  • Familiarity with industry best practices such as Six Sigma, Lean Manufacturing, etc.
  • Ability to work effectively in a fast-paced, cross-functional team environment.

Nice To Haves

  • 5+ years of experience in reliability engineering within the aviation industry, ideally supporting USAF fighter aircraft.
  • Certified Reliability Engineer (CRE) - ASQ or equivalent.
  • Master's degree in mechanical, Electrical, or Aerospace Engineering.
  • Demonstrated experience with reliability-centered maintenance (RCM), total productive maintenance (TPM), and root cause analysis (RCA).
  • Knowledge of military aviation standards and sustainment practices.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ement reliability-centered maintenance (RCM) strategies and predictive maintenance plans.
  • Analyze equipment failures and system downtime to identify root causes and reliability risks.
  • Design and execute reliability tests to validate system performance and compliance with safety standards.
  • Collaborate with engineering, maintenance, and manufacturing teams to improve equipment reliability and lifecycle performance.
  • Lead reliability improvement initiatives to reduce unplanned downtime and increase mission readiness.
  • Utilize statistical tools and diagnostic software to analyze performance data and recommend improvements.
  • Prepare technical reports, failure analysis documentation, and reliability recommendations for leadership.
  • Support the development of repair procedures and test equipment for non-repairable components.
  • Maintain reliability databases and track performance metrics across systems and components.
